From c1913716c21fa411f91c409e07bae986c88bcf63 Mon Sep 17 00:00:00 2001
From: foreman
Date: Tue, 18 Sep 2018 16:47:41 -0400
Subject: [PATCH] P4 to Git Change 1607596 by jatang@jatang_win_pal_lc on
2018/09/18 16:37:51
SWDEV-126897 - Remove calling setDynamicParallelFlag() from submitKernelInternal() in LC/ROCm path.
For LC, setDynamicParallelFlag() is now called at Kernel::InitParameters().
Affected files ...
... //depot/stg/opencl/drivers/opencl/runtime/device/rocm/rocvirtual.cpp#69 edit
[ROCm/clr commit: f8e1706822cb275cf0bf1e92f94164425e360f6f]
---
proj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p | 2 --
1 file changed, 2 deletions(-)
diff --git a/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p b/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p
index c0679a7170..02695afa04 100644
--- a/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p
+++ b/projects/clr/rocclr/runtime/device/rocm/rocvirtual.cpp
@@ -374,7 +374,6 @@ bool VirtualGPU::processMemObjects(const amd::Kernel& kernel, const_address para
if (!createVirtualQueue(queue->size()) || !createSchedulerParam()) {
return false;
}
- hsaKernel.setDynamicParallelFlag(true);
uint64_t vqVA = getVQVirtualAddress();
WriteAqlArgAt(const_cast(params), &vqVA, sizeof(vqVA), desc.offset_);
}
@@ -2065,7 +2064,6 @@ bool VirtualGPU::submitKernelInternal(const amd::NDRangeContainer& sizes, const
if (!createVirtualQueue(defQueue->size()) || !createSchedulerParam()) {
return false;
}
- gpuKernel.setDynamicParallelFlag(true);
vqVA = getVQVirtualAddress();
}
WriteAqlArgAt(const_cast(parameters), &vqVA, it.size_, it.offset_);